how to clean a stone mortar and pestle?

Answer

  1. To clean a stone mortar and pestle, start by scraping off any residue with a spoon or knife.
  2. Next, soak the mortar and pestle in warm water and dish soap for a few minutes.
  3. Finally, scrub the mortar and pestle with a brush to remove any remaining residue.

How do you season a new stone mortar and pestle?

To season a new stone mortar and pestle, start by grinding a little salt or rice into the mortar. Next, add a few drops of oil and continue grinding. Finally, add a little water and continue grinding. Repeat this process until the mortar and pestle are well seasoned.

How do you clean granite mortar and pestle after use?

To clean a granite mortar and pestle, first rinse it off with water to remove any residue. Then, use a soft cloth to scrub the surface of the mortar and pestle. If needed, you can use a mild dish detergent to help remove any stubborn stains. Finally, rinse it off again with water and let it air dry.

Can you put a stone mortar and pestle in the dishwasher?

Yes, you can put a stone mortar and pestle in the dishwasher. However, I would recommend hand-washing it instead, as the dishwasher can be harsh on the mortar and pestle.

Which material is best for mortar and pestle?

There is no definitive answer to this question as different materials can work better depending on the specific application. In general, a mortar and pestle made of a hard, non-porous material like granite or marble will be best for grinding and crushing herbs and spices, while a softer material like wood or plastic may be better for making pastes.
